Post subject: HELP!!!!

Hey ya'll......have just recently done a fresh install of FS9 to my fresh installed windows XP....(fired vista..lol)...All is well but I have installed only a couple jets thus far...which I had previously!.....anyways I'm having A stutter in VC only....I can't remember if there is a fix for it or not.....any help would be a blessing!...thanks

Hey Hoppa,

What's going on here with your new hotrod multi-core CPU machine with WinXP (as opposed to your older single-core CPU Pentium system) is essentially 'contention' between the multiple CPU's (you have two CPU's in one on a dual-core and 4 CPU's on a quad-core, which is what you bought, right?). Each core is trying to run "some" of the FS9 code and FS9 is an older program written in the days before multi-core CPU's were around. So the CPU's are fighting over who gets to do what with FS9. I think this shows up in VC more than anywhere else becuase of the extra code embedded inside gauges that has to be executed, etc...just a guess though.

So anyway, the CPU's get a little out of step with each other amid all that. That's your stutter.

A way you can prove this for yourself with FS9 running is to ALT-TAB to the desktop (if you're in fullscreen mode), press CTRL-SHIFT-DEL to call up the WindowsXP applet that lets you launch Task Manager, go ahead and launch Task Manager, go to the "Processes" tab, find the FS9.exe entry, right-click on it, and select "Set Affinity". Notice it shows you how many CPU's you have runnign the task....you shoudl show 2 or 4 (dual or quad core). Click the little green checkmarks so that just CPU0 is set active. Hit K and close Task manager, go back to FS9, stutters should be gone.

To fix this permanently, Microsoft has a "hotfix" for this which should help:

support.microsoft.com/...6256/en-us

Not sure it's also needed but may not be a bad idea to get this one too while you're at it:

support.microsoft.com/...6357/en-us

I got the same thing when I first set up WinXP on my new dual-core machine, boy it ran fast but stuttery from the VC with FS9. FSX was fine (because with SP1/SP2 it is written for multi-core CPU's). Thought I had screwed something up big-time. It went away on it's own and now I realize it's just because I have my system set to download and install automatic updates, which at some point included this hotfix.

Should fix ya right up.

Couple other things on the checklist :

- You've installed the 9.1 update for FS2004, right?

- Also, when doing a format/reinstall of an operating system (in this case, going from Vista back to XP) you should reinstall any motherboard or chipset drivers - look for a CD that came with the system or motherboard. That could explain less-than-optimum performance right there.

Could sound too simple but I'd de-frag the hard drive. Think your guy would have done it but maybe not. When you do fresh install of an operating system and all your programs your drive gets fragmented big time and I know that MSFS doesn't seem to run good on a drive that's even got minor fragmentation going on. Also don't trust XP if it tells you you don't need to de-frag. I've noticed a difference after de-fraging when I was told by XP I didn't need to.

Not guaranteeing it will solve the problem, but couldn't hurt and I like to try the simple stuff first. Wink
